Draymond Green on Klay Thompson Leaving Warriors

While Klay Thompson’s departure was tough for many, it hit Draymond Green and Stephen Curry the hardest.

The trio formed the core of the Warriors dynasty, and seeing one of The Splash Brothers leave for a fresh start was emotional. But Green understands there was more to Thompson’s decision than just basketball.

On the “Club 520 Podcast,” Green expressed his feelings: โ€œIโ€™m happy as hell he gone. The reason Iโ€™m happy heโ€™s gone is because he wasnโ€™t happy no more. As a brother, I only want whatโ€™s best for you, not whatโ€™s best for me, not whatโ€™s best for this team.”

Thompson’s Unhappiness

Green’s mention of Thompson being unhappy isn’t shocking but it’s the first time it’s been said out loud. Given how contract talks went between Thompson and the Warriors, it’s easy to see why he’d feel let down by the team that drafted him in 2011.

Fans might think it’s sad to see such a key player leave after so many years with one team.

Now, Thompson will join Luka Doncic and Kyrie Irving on the Dallas Mavericks . He’ll get plenty of chances to play against his old team as they are now Western Conference champions.
